Decades of sustainability work lay the foundation for the future
Finland is highly committed to global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and has continuously been ranked number one in an international comparison of sustainable development. The comparison assesses countries’ progress in implementing the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development. Finland's Ministry of Economic Affairs and Employment, responsible for country’s tourism policy, has identified four priorities set to facilitate the sustainable growth and renewal of the tourism sector in Finland, with the first priority being supporting sustainable development.
For example, Finland ranks 3rd on the Social Progress Index 2022, 2nd on the Corruption Perception Index 2022, and 2nd in Euromonitor Sustainable Tourism Index.
